SAMPLE mode
Check the sample name and waveform, then set the playback range with START and END.
Use REC, ADSR, LOAD SAMPLE, DEL SAMPLE, and RESET.
Select the pad you want to edit first.
Adjust pitch, filter, volume, and playback behavior.
The free plan can import audio up to 10 seconds. The Premium plan can import audio up to 60 seconds.
If the destination pad already has a sound, confirming the recording replaces the existing sample.
Move START and END on the waveform to show TRIM. Running TRIM overwrites the sample with the current range.
Duplicate the project first if you need a backup. Pad settings such as pitch and ADSR are kept.

SEQUENCE mode
Tap cells to turn steps on or off.
Adjust bar count, Swing, and the selected pad pattern. Use the arrows on the left and right of the grid to move between bars.
Changing pads switches the grid to that pad’s sequence.
Control playback, stop, realtime recording, and quantize.
Changes the overall speed.
Delays even-feel offbeat steps for a swung rhythm.
Records pads you hit while the sequence is playing.
Aligns realtime-recorded hits to the step grid.
BAR+ adds a bar, and BAR- removes the last bar. The free plan is limited to 2 Bars. The Premium plan supports up to 8 Bars.
In SEQUENCE mode, the four knobs work as DIST., DL. TIME, DL. FBK., and DL. LV.
CLEAR clears the sequence for the selected pad.
Tap IMP EXP to choose IMPORT JSON or EXPORT JSON. You can import or export the sequence BPM, Swing, step data, and SAMPLE parameters as JSON.
IMPORT JSON overwrites the current project sequence and SAMPLE parameters. Audio files are not included.

PROJECT mode
Shows sample count, missing files, and data size.
Use NEW, COPY, DELETE, and EXPORT WAV.
Pressing a pad in PROJECT moves to SAMPLE and plays that sound.
Play or stop the saved pattern.
A project stores samples, pad settings, sequences, BPM, and related work data.
Create an empty project.
Duplicate the current project. Use it as a backup before editing.
Delete the selected project.
Export the current sequence as a WAV file.
Check the target project carefully before deleting from the list menu or swipe action.
When effects are included, a 2-second tail is added to preserve reverb or delay decay. Without effects, the WAV is exported at the exact sequence length.
WAV export is a Premium feature.

Data specs
These values match the app’s import, recording, save, and export limits. A file may still fail to load if it is damaged, empty, protected, or unsupported by the device.
| Item | Specification |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Supported formats | iOS-readable audio, WAV, AIFF, MP3, MPEG-4 Audio | Select one audio file from the file picker. |
| File size | Up to 20MB | Files larger than 20MB cannot be imported. |
| Channels | Up to 2ch | Mono and stereo files are supported. |
| Import duration | Free plan: up to 10 seconds Premium plan: up to 60 seconds | Shorten longer files before importing. |
| Empty files | Not supported | Audio files with zero length cannot be imported. |
| Item | Specification |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Recording duration | Free plan: up to 10 seconds Premium plan: up to 30 seconds | After recording, choose “Use this recording” to assign it to the current pad. |
| Temporary recording format | CAF | This is used internally while recording. |
| Sample rate | 44.1kHz | Used when saving microphone recordings. |
| Item | Specification |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Pads | 16 pads per bank / up to 4 banks and 64 pads | The free plan can use the upper 8 pads in Bank A. |
| Sequence length | 1 Bar = 16 steps Free plan: 2 Bars Premium plan: up to 8 Bars | Up to 128 steps are available. |
| BPM | 40 to 300 | Change it with TAP or BPM controls. |
| Swing | 0% / 25% / 50% / 75% | SWING cycles in 25% increments. |
| Pad name | Up to 32 characters | Long names are limited when saved. |
| Project name | Up to 48 characters | Names may be sanitized for file compatibility. |
| Item | Specification |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Project archive | Up to 512MB | Limit for imported project files. |
| WAV export | Premium feature | Run it from EXPORT WAV in PROJECT mode. |
| Export loop count | 1 to 32 loops | Choose how many times the sequence repeats in the exported audio. |
| Export format | WAV / 44.1kHz / 2ch | Creates the full sequence as a stereo WAV file. |
| Effects ON | Adds a 2-second tail | Preserves delay, reverb, and other effect decay. |
| Effects OFF | Exact sequence length | Exports without extra silence. |
